Guys, we could be looking at the last days of Chase Utley in a Philadelphia Phillies uniform.
On Thursday, the Phils activated their 36-year-old second baseman from the disabled list, and manager Pete Mackanin said he will play about 4-5 times a week, as Cesar Hernandez, Freddy Galvis and Odubel Herrera move around all over the place in order for everyone to get some playing time. And with Utley's vesting option for 2016 now out the window, he is an impending free agent. That means two things.
One, we could be seeing Chase Utley for the very last time in a Phils uniform. And two, it's highly possible the Phillies are going to trade him in a matter of weeks. So, say your goodbyes now, guys.
